The typical annual salary range for most roles at FULC.org is approximately from $74,206 to $97,100.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ills, and location.
The average annual salary at FULC.org is $84,859, or an hourly wage of $41, in comparison to Two Rivers Church which pays $83,804 per year or $40 per hour.
Yes, salaries often differ between departments at FULC.org due to varying market demand for specific skill sets and the nature of the roles. For example, technical roles in Engineering or IT may command different salary ranges compared to roles in Marketing or Human Resources.
Experience level is a significant factor in determining salary at FULC.org, as it is with most employers. Generally, employees with more years of relevant experience and a proven track record can command higher salaries. For example, a senior-level role will typically have a higher pay band than an entry-level or mid-career position within the same job family.
